  • This recipe for slow cooker Cube Steaks is flavorful, your family will really enjoy this 6 ingredient recipe.
    Ingredients:
    1 can Cream of Chicken Soup (10.5 ounces)
    1 can French Onion Soup (10.5 ounces)
    1 package Au Jus Gravy Mix (1 ounce or 28 grams)
    1 Tablespoon Tomato Paste
    1 cup water
    2 pounds Cube Steaks or up to 3 pounds
    3 Tablespoons Cornstarch
    4 Tablespoons water
    Combine the first 4 ingredients in your Crock Pot.
    Add your beef.
    Cook on LOW for 5 to 5 and 1/2 hours.
    Turn your Slow Cooker to HIGH and add your Cornstarch/Water mixture and cook for 30 more minutes.
    Serve!
